    Supplies:
    Holbein watercolor: Prussian blue, peacock blue,, , quinachradone magenta, cadmium yellow deep burnt umber,
    black gouache
    Princeton no. 3/8 flat wash brush, 1" craft wash brush
    arches 100% cotton cold press paper 8 x 10"

      Deborah Peek: Hi! Just use any 3/8 in flat brush, and any 1". Actually, paper is the most important part; it is nearly impossible to create a successful painting on cheap and thin paper. Canson is just ok; I like Bee paper, and use it often. If you notice, Ellen uses Arches, and that is my favorite too. It is more expensive, but worth it. After you have practiced a bit, I suggest you try it too. Back to brushes: My 3/8 in is one I've had for years from when I first started watercolor, and didn't know anything about brushes yet. I bought it at a craft store, and chose it because I liked the clear blue handle! 😊 I'm still enjoying using it. I only use synthetic brushes, and I can suggest the Simply Simmons line. They are a good starter brush, you can find them various places, and they are pretty inexpensive. Hope this helps! Happy painting! ♥️😻♥️
